Scaffolding accidents are unfortunately common in construction and other industries, often resulting in severe injuries or even fatalities. This article will explore the role of a scaffolding injury lawyer, common causes of scaffolding accidents, and the steps you should take if you’ve been injured.Scaffolding accidents can occur due to a variety of reasons, including:
- Faulty equipment: Poorly maintained or defective scaffolding can collapse or fail, leading to serious injuries.
- Lack of training: Workers who are not properly trained on scaffolding safety protocols are at higher risk of accidents.
- Negligence: Employers or contractors may fail to provide adequate safety measures, such as guardrails or harnesses.
- Weather conditions: High winds, rain, or ice can make scaffolding unstable and dangerous.

Compensation in scaffolding injury cases may cover:
- Medical expenses: This includes hospital bills, surgeries, rehabilitation, and ongoing care.
- Lost wages: If your injury prevents you from working, you may be compensated for lost income.
- Pain and suffering: Compensation for physical and emotional distress caused by the accident.
- Disability or disfigurement: If the injury results in permanent disability or scarring, you may receive additional compensation.
